Some personal notes on topics raised at the panel on LLMs:
- NLP and Computational Linguists diverging
- Vertical applications becoming horizontal layers
- Role of open and closed source LLMs depending on usage
- Environmental concerns relevant
- Malicious actors using LLMs and the need for regulations
- NLP is becoming the natural science studying how LLMs work
- Academic research and research at tech companies enabling diversity (in academia) and scale (in industry)

Hey β€”we all know better than to use NLP tools that we can't assess, right? These folks are advertising on the Rocket.chat, but give 0 info about how their system was built or evaluated.

The link for generalizable.xyz goes to a page that literally just consists of their logo.

In what sense is this GPT? What training data did they use? What test data? What evaluation metric?

But more to the pt: We're here to learn from each other, not to read synthetic versions of papers.
